"After dark, when we are thinking about going to sleep, many amazing animals are just waking up. What do they do in the dark of the night? *Bats fly out of caves, zigzagging into the sky. * Wolf pups wrestle, growl, and romp. *Tarantulas emerge from their lairs--leg by leg by leg. *Fireflies flit through lawns, their flashes lighting up the dark. With this engaging collection of twenty-one poems, learn about the hidden lives of these nocturnal animals...

"Many animals build remarkable structures in order to attract mates, lay eggs, give birth, and otherwise perpetuate their species. Twelve animals are presented in four sections based on where they live--underground, in the water, on the land, or in the air. Fish, insects, reptiles, mammals, and birds are included in poems and artwork that to bring these animals to life for kids."--
